上一页 1 ··· 34 35 36 37 38 39 40 41 42 ··· 61 下一页
  2019年9月21日
摘要: 1 代码演练 1.1 动态代理 2 疑难解答 2.1 动态代理invoke怎么执行的? 2.2 感觉这块理解的不是很好,下边有时间再看看 重点: 重点关注动态代理类 测试类: 动态代理类: 订单类: 订单dao: 订单daoIMPL: 订单Service: 订单ServiceIMPL: 打印日志: 阅读全文
posted @ 2019-09-21 16:08 菜鸟乙 阅读(211) 评论(0) 推荐(0) 编辑
摘要: 1 课程讲解 1.1 类型: 1.2 定义: 1.3 适用场景: 1.4 优点: 1.5 缺点: 1.6 与其他设计模式关系: 1 课程讲解 1.1 类型: 行为型 1.2 定义: ◆定义:提供一种方法,顺序访问一个集合对象中的各个元素,而又不暴露该对象的内部表示 1.3 适用场景: ◆访问一个集合 阅读全文
posted @ 2019-09-21 11:40 菜鸟乙 阅读(184) 评论(0) 推荐(0) 编辑
摘要: 1 源码解析 1.1 源码解析1(在jdk中的使用) 1.2 源码解析2(在servlet中的应用) 1.3 源码解析3(在mybaties中的应用) AbstractList(父类) ArrayList(子类) 同理:AbstractSet,AbstractMap同样采用了模版方法模式 HttpS 阅读全文
posted @ 2019-09-21 11:23 菜鸟乙 阅读(159) 评论(0) 推荐(0) 编辑
  2019年9月20日
摘要: 1 代码演练 1.1 代码演练1 1.2 代码演练2(后端课程子类运用钩子方法,加入写手记的方法) 1.3 代码演练3(前端有多个子类,有得需要写手记,有得不需要写,如何实现?) 目的: 木木网制作课程视频父类,前端课程子类和设计模式子类。父类需要制作PPT,制作视频,制作手记,包装课程四个部分,且 阅读全文
posted @ 2019-09-20 06:36 菜鸟乙 阅读(172) 评论(0) 推荐(0) 编辑
  2019年9月19日
摘要: 1 课程讲解 1.1 类型: 1.2 定义: 1.3 适用场景: 1.4 优点: 1.5 缺点: 1.6 模板方法扩展: 1.7 与其他设计模式关系: 1 课程讲解 1.1 类型: 行为型 1.2 定义: ◆定义:定义了一个算法的骨架,并允许子类为一个或多个步骤提供实现◆模板方法使得子类可以在不改变 阅读全文
posted @ 2019-09-19 06:24 菜鸟乙 阅读(190) 评论(0) 推荐(0) 编辑
  2019年9月17日
摘要: https://coding.imooc.com/lesson/270.html#mid=18123 1 代码演练 1.1 代码演练1(静态代理之分库操作) 1 代码演练 1.1 代码演练1(静态代理之分库操作) 需求: 订单管理,模拟前置后置方法,模拟分库管理 重点: 重点看订单静态代理,动态数据 阅读全文
posted @ 2019-09-17 06:33 菜鸟乙 阅读(220) 评论(0) 推荐(0) 编辑
  2019年9月15日
摘要: 1 课程讲解 1.1 类型: 1.2 定义: 1.3 适用场景: 1.4 优点: 1.5 缺点: 1.6 与其他设计模式关系: 结构型 ◆定义:为其他对象提供一种代理,以控制对这个对象的访问◆代理对象在客户端和目标对象之间起到中介的作用 比喻:目标对象可以理解为房东,客户端代表你,房屋中介代表中介, 阅读全文
posted @ 2019-09-15 16:53 菜鸟乙 阅读(194) 评论(0) 推荐(0) 编辑
摘要: 1 桥接模式源码解析 1.1 源码解析1 jdk中的应用(驱动类) 步骤: class.forName 调取驱动接口的静态块,触发驱动管理类DriverManager 的注册驱动方法,从而将该驱动放到CopyOnWriteArrayList中。 getConnect方法是通过传入url用户名密码。 阅读全文
posted @ 2019-09-15 16:30 菜鸟乙 阅读(169) 评论(0) 推荐(0) 编辑
摘要: 1 代码演练 1.1 代码演练1 1.2 代码演练2 需求: 打印出从银行获取的账号类 优点: a 假如我只用用一个银行接口 去获取账号的内容,银行实现类要有定期账号和活期账号两个方法,如果实现类特别多,很容易类爆炸。 b 而使用桥接模式可以 让实现(账号类)和抽象(银行类)分离,银行属性增加修改银 阅读全文
posted @ 2019-09-15 14:05 菜鸟乙 阅读(181) 评论(0) 推荐(0) 编辑
摘要: 1 桥接模式讲解 1.1 类型: 1.2 定义: 1.3 适用场景: 1.4 优点: 1.5 缺点: 1.6 与其他设计模式关系: 结构型 ◆定义:将抽象部分与它的具体实现部分分离,使它们都可以独立地变化◆合成复用原则中提到:优先通过组合的方式建立两个类之间联系,而不是继承,继承过多会发生类爆炸的情 阅读全文
posted @ 2019-09-15 14:03 菜鸟乙 阅读(193) 评论(0) 推荐(0) 编辑
上一页 1 ··· 34 35 36 37 38 39 40 41 42 ··· 61 下一页